From the Studio
It's 1947 Hollywood, and Eddie Valiant (Bob Hoskins), a down-on-his-luck detective, is hired to find proof that Marvin Acme, gag factory mogul and owner of Toontown, is playing hanky-panky with femme fatale Jessica Rabbit, wife of Maroon Cartoon superstar Roger Rabbit. When Acme is found murdered, all fingers point to Roger, and the sinister, power-hungry Judge Doom (Christopher Lloyd) is on a mission to bring Roger to justice. Roger begs the Toon-hating Valiant to find the real evildoer and the plot thickens as Eddie uncovers scandal after scandal and realizes the very existence of Toontown is at stake! WHO FRAMED ROGER RABBIT is deliciously outrageous fun the whole family will enjoy.

Special Features
Disc One - Family Friendly

  • The Roger Rabbit Shorts - Tummy Trouble, Rollercoaster Rabbit, Trail Mix-Up
  • "Who Made Roger Rabbit" mini-documentary hosted by Charles Fleischer, the voice of Roger Rabbit
  • "Trouble in Toontown" set-top DVD game
  • Specifications:
    • Fullscreen (1.33:1)
    • Dolby Digital 5.1 Surround Sound
    • THX-Certified
    • French and Spanish Language Tracks

Disc Two - Enthusiast

  • Audio Commentary with filmmakers Robert Zemeckis, Frank Marshall, Jeffrey Price, Peter Seaman, Steve Starkey and Ken Ralston
  • "Toowntown Confidential" - viewing option with intriguing and hilarious facts and trivia
  • Deleted Scene - "The Pig Head Sequence" with filmmaker commentary
  • "Before and After" - split-screen comparison with and without animation
  • "Toon Stand-Ins" Featurette - rehearsing with stand-ins for the Toons
  • "On-Set! Benny the Cab" - the making of a scene from the film
  • "The Valiant Files" - an interactive set-top gallery
  • Specifications
    • Widescreen (1.85:1) - Enchanced for 16X9 televisions
    • DTS 5.1 Digital Surround Sound
    • Dolby Digital 5.1 Surround Sound
    • THX-Cerfified Includes THX Optimizer
    • French and Spanish Language Tracks

Plus

  • Companion Booklet
  • 2 Collectible Glossies
